How to read the lines

Sample line


Thu 9/6 New Orleans Saints +6 +223 OVER 52.5
(Date, VISITING TEAM: Point Spread, Money Line, Over/Under)
7:30 PM Indianapolis Colts -6 -243 UNDER 52.5

(Time, HOME TEAM: Point Spread, Money Line, Over/Under)

How to bet the Money Line

Sample line
SAINTS +223
COLTS -243

First off, a money bet is a straight up win/lose bet. No points involved, so of course there are odds payoffs.

If you want to bet on the Saints, you will win $223 for every $100 that you bet. Conversely, for the Colts, you will win $100 for every $243 that you bet.

In other words, the team with the - money line is the favorite (therefore lower payout) and the team with the + is the under dog.
